OREANDA-NEWS. February 2, 2009. The Russian government could obtain a minority stake in Rusal, the company's head Oleg Deripaska said. The state could become a minority shareholder as a result of the aluminum maker's converted bonds. Deripaska has refused to disclose information about the company's debt, although according to him, negotiations with banks over debt restructuring are in progress. He went on to say that the update on the issue will be reported within a month.

"This will become more or less clear by the end of February. We have discussed the issue, since we have raised a loan from Vnesheconombank and are now discussing our long-term decision", Deripaska replied when asked whether the state could become a minority shareholder of RusAl. However, the state is not striving to obtain a stake in the aluminum maker. As matter of fact, nothing of the kind is going on".
